Description
Summary:Fusion energy is produced by burning hydrogen which is available from water. It is the energy source of the sun. It produces neither greenhouses gases nor long-lived nuclear waste. Here the authors describe how to use powerful lasers to ignite the hydrogen fuel and the physics of this future energy source
